Output 623420314d3e6a0e8612990d80a0d597199d0b687c4d4436128be7bfe4255d79:1

value
19519839475
script pubkey
OP_0 OP_PUSHBYTES_20 7e2ea7c63c2c95d87f36bd2fe1e7d8e3d7b559fe
address
bc1q0ch2033u9j2aslekh5h7re7cu0tm2k07zav7e7
transaction
623420314d3e6a0e8612990d80a0d597199d0b687c4d4436128be7bfe4255d79
spent
true